Responsibilities

  • Responsible for managing health problems related to allergies, asthma, and immunology
  • Work independently and collaboratively with Physician and nursing staff
  • Perform history and physical exams for new and established patients
  • Prescribe appropriate medications and order diagnostic/laboratory tests in accordance with patient’s needs
  • Develop care plans and implement treatment plans based on clinical decisions
  • Provide excellent, efficient, and patient-focused service in a fast-paced practice
  • Work well with ancillary staff and management to support core values of the practice
  • Travel to satellite offices, as needed.
